Abstract
A preferred embodiment of the present invention can accept an indication of a domain name or set of domain names from interested entity. The desired domain names are names that an interested entity desires to register through a domain name registration system or systems, such as that operated by a registry-accredited registrar. The system can closely monitor the domain name registry or registrar databases used to provide domain name resolution or registration over a distributed network, such as the Internet, and determine the expiration or availability of the name or names supplied by the interested entity. When a desired domain name appears to be available, the system can register or re-register the domain name through a domain registration service. If there is more than one interested entity for a domain name, the system can also facilitate an auction for the domain name.

13. A method for domain name management comprising the steps of:
-
receiving from an interested entity a request to monitor a domain name registration maintained by a registry;
monitoring a current status of the domain name registration;
detecting that the domain name registration has expired;
determining a deletion time period during which the domain name is expected to delete from the registry; and
during the expected deletion time period but prior to deletion, requesting a new registration of the domain name to succeed the expired domain name registration. - View Dependent Claims (14, 15)

16. A method for domain name management comprising the steps of:
-
receiving from an interested entity a request to acquire a domain name registration maintained by a registry;
detecting that the domain name registration has expired;
estimating a deletion time at which the domain name is expected to delete from the registry; and
prior to the estimated deletion time, requesting a new registration of the domain name to succeed the expired domain name registration, thereby acquiring the domain name prior to deletion from the registry. - View Dependent Claims (17, 18)
